replmd: Handle conflicts for single-valued link attributes better

If 2 DCs independently set a single-valued linked attribute to differing
values, Samba should be able to resolve this problem when replication
occurs.

If the received information is better, then we want to set the existing
link attribute in our DB as inactive.

If our own information is better, then we still want to add the received
link attribute, but mark it as inactive so that it doesn't clobber our
own link.

This still isn't a complete solution. When we add the received attribute
as inactive, we really should be incrementing the version, updating the
USN, etc. Also this only deals with the case where the received link is
completely new (i.e. a received link conflicting with an existing
inactive link isn't handled).
